PACESETTERS NAMED AT ABAC

TIFTON—Eight individuals at Abraham Baldwin Agricultural College recently received Pacesetter Awards from the campus newspaper’s editorial board and staff. A Superior Pacesetter Award was also presented to Amanda Roberts, an art major from Twin City.

The institution’s award-winning student newspaper, The Stallion, extends Pacesetter recognition annually to those who have worked for ABAC through their actions and exemplary service. Pacesetters are chosen from the student body, the administration, the faculty, and the staff who, through their hard work, talent, and devotion, embody the spirit of the college.

 

This year’s faculty and staff Pacesetter Award recipients included Brenda Doss, Administrative Associate in the Academic Affairs office; Lorie Felton, Assistant Professor of Environmental Horticulture; Jeffrey Newberry, Assistant Professor of English; and Ashley Williamson, Public Relations Assistant. Jack Larry, Sodexho Custodial Supervisor, received the honorary award posthumously. Larry passed away in December, 2007. His wife, Juanita, accepted the award on his behalf.

Student Pacesetter award recipients included Scott Barron, an Ag Education major from Woodstock; Willie Dean, a Middle Grade Education major from Tifton; and Taylor Hand, an undecided major from Tifton.
